Engine Overheating: The Most Critical Concern.



Your engine creates substantial quantities of warm throughout typical operation, and when external temperatures soar, the air conditioning system need to burn the midnight oil to preserve risk-free operating temperatures. The radiator, water pump, thermostat, and coolant all play essential roles in this procedure, yet extreme heat can bewilder also well-kept systems.



When engines overheat, the consequences can be extreme and costly. Metal parts broaden beyond their designed tolerances, possibly triggering warped cyndrical tube heads, blown head gaskets, or total engine seizure. These repair work can set you back countless dollars and leave you stranded on busy freeways during the most awful possible problems.



The warning signs of engine getting too hot include climbing temperature gauges, heavy steam coming from under the hood, uncommon scents, and minimized engine efficiency. Nevertheless, by the time these symptoms appear, substantial damage might have currently occurred. Avoidance through routine upkeep and understanding your automobile's limits ends up being essential throughout heatwave problems.



Modern cars consist of innovative engine management systems that can assist shield against overheating, however these precaution have their limits. When ambient temperatures climb over 95 levels and you're sitting in stop-and-go web traffic with the cooling running at maximum capacity, even the best-designed air conditioning system encounters severe stress and anxiety.



Air Conditioning Systems Under Extreme Stress.



During Central Pennsylvania heatwaves, air conditioning systems work more challenging than at any other time of the year. The temperature level difference in between the scorching exterior air and the comfy interior you want can go beyond 40 levels, needing your air conditioner system to run at optimal ability for extensive durations.



This boosted work places significant pressure on the compressor, the heart of your cooling system. Compressor failing during summer season is one of the most usual auto fixing problems, commonly leaving motorists without relief from oppressive heat. The refrigerant lines, condenser, and evaporator also encounter boosted pressure and potential failing factors during severe temperature problems.



Past mechanical tension, your air conditioning system straight impacts gas effectiveness during heatwaves. Running air conditioning at maximum ability can decrease gas economic climate by up to 25 percent, suggesting more constant stops at filling station and higher running costs throughout the hottest climate. This creates a hard balance in between convenience, security, and financial considerations for lots of drivers.



The cabin air filter, commonly neglected throughout regular upkeep, ends up being specifically important during heatwaves. A stopped up filter compels the AC system to work also harder, potentially bring about early failure and decreased cooling down performance when you require it most.



Battery Performance in Scorching Temperatures.



Severe heat affects vehicle batteries in manner ins which several drivers don't fully comprehend. While the majority of people associate battery issues with cold weather, extreme heat can be equally harmful and often more immediately problematic.



High temperatures increase the chain reactions inside batteries, causing them to lose capacity and fail prematurely. The intense heat under the hood during summertime driving can press battery temperature levels well over their ideal operating variety, leading to internal damages that might not emerge up until the battery stops working totally.



Warm additionally creates battery liquid to evaporate faster, potentially exposing internal plates and creating irreversible damage. Modern sealed batteries are much less vulnerable to fluid loss, but they're not immune to heat-related degradation. A battery that executes well throughout moderate temperature levels may struggle to begin your engine after sitting in intense heat for several hours.



The electric needs on your automobile also raise throughout heatwaves. Air conditioning, cooling down followers, and other heat-management systems draw even more power from the battery and billing system, developing added stress and anxiety on these elements when they're currently operating under tough conditions.



Tire Safety and Performance Issues.



Warm asphalt and severe air temperatures produce dangerous conditions for automobile tires throughout Central Pennsylvania. Roadway surface temperatures can go beyond 140 degrees Fahrenheit during height summer heat, triggering tire rubber to soften and put on more rapidly than normal.



Underinflated tires end up being specifically unsafe during heatwaves. The combination of low air pressure and extreme warm can cause catastrophic tire failure, including blowouts that can create major mishaps. Even correctly pumped up tires encounter raised wear prices and lowered efficiency when subjected to sustained heats.



The warm also affects tire pressure itself. For every single 10-degree boost in temperature, tire stress rises by around 1-2 PSI. This indicates that tires appropriately inflated throughout cooler early morning hours might become overinflated as temperature levels rise throughout the day, possibly influencing handling and raising the danger of damage from roadway risks.



Parking on warm asphalt for prolonged periods can trigger permanent tire damages, consisting of flat areas and rubber degradation. Shopping mall, airports, and other huge paved locations become especially bothersome during heatwave conditions, as the dark asphalt takes in and retains massive amounts of heat.

Fluid System Challenges.



Car fluids deal with considerable difficulties during extreme warm conditions in Central Pennsylvania. Engine oil, transmission fluid, brake fluid, and coolant all have particular temperature ranges where they carry out efficiently, and heatwaves can push these liquids beyond their effective limits.



Electric motor oil thickness adjustments with temperature level, ending up being thinner as heat rises. While contemporary multi-grade oils are developed to handle temperature level variations, severe heat can still influence their protective properties and lubrication efficiency. This can lead to raised engine wear and prospective mechanical troubles, especially in older vehicles or those with higher gas mileage.



Transmission liquid deals with comparable challenges, with severe warmth potentially causing the liquid to break down and shed its lubricating and cooling properties. Automatic transmissions produce substantial heat during typical operation, and exterior temperature level extremes can overwhelm the transmission cooling system, leading to costly fixings.



Brake liquid can soak up dampness from the air, and heats can create this dampness to steam, developing vapor bubbles in the brake lines. This problem, called brake discolor, can considerably reduce stopping performance and develop hazardous driving problems, especially during stop-and-go traffic usual in city locations.

Gas System Impacts.



Gas and diesel fuel both face challenges throughout severe warm conditions. Gas growth due to heats can influence fuel system elements and engine performance, while vapor lock can happen when fuel overheats and kinds gas bubbles in the fuel line.



Modern gas shot systems are generally extra immune to heat-related problems than older carburetor-equipped vehicles, however they're not unsusceptible to temperature-related problems. Fuel pumps, situated inside the gas storage tank, can overheat when fuel degrees are reduced, as the gas aids cool these elements throughout normal operation.



The gas tank itself can be impacted by severe warmth, with plastic tanks being especially at risk to warping or fracturing. Steel tanks deal with deterioration issues when condensation kinds as a result of temperature level fluctuations between night and day throughout heatwave conditions.



Fuel economic situation additionally suffers throughout severe warmth problems, as engines have to function harder to maintain performance, cooling systems run at optimal ability, and hot air is less thick, influencing burning performance.
